Daredevil - His Worst Enemy - Max Barnard

The Premise: What's Daredevil's biggest weakness? His lack of sight? No, not at all. It's something much less utilised in his stories, mostly because Daredevil is known to be a *shudder* serious title. This page is some unknown amount of pages into a larger storyline, because who needs a page 1 all the time? (answer: me)

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Page X - 8 Panels

1-- Daredevil, peering stealthily around a street corner at 3 thugs.

NARRATION/DAREDEVIL - I don't like this. Jimmy The Tooth said that there would be four thugs at the drop-off point. Three goons and the new 'protection'. Why can I only sense the goons?


2-- A blurred shape collides with Daredevil, sending him towards the ground.

SPEECH BUBBLE/DAREDEVIL - WHUFF!

NARRATION/DAREDEVIL - What? Where did that come from?


3-- Close-up on Daredevil lying on the street as he takes a hit to the face from the left. It's important that we still don't see WHAT is hitting him, in an attempt to keep the mystery up.

SFX - RYNK!

NARRATION/DAREDEVIL - I can't even tell if something's hitting me.


4-- Same as the previous panel's set-up, except Daredevil's face is being hit in the other direction with two rapid hits.

SFX - SIMN! MCK!

NARRATION/DAREDEVIL - But I can feel every blow coursing through my body.


5-- Continuing the close-up face-punching, back to a hit from the left. Daredevil now has blood trickling out of his nose, mouth, and from somewhere under his mask.

SFX - ROLHSST!

NARRATION/DAREDEVIL - NNGH! What's with the noises I'm hearing?


6-- Now Daredevil's taking a hit to the chin.

SFX - MATTADUAR!

NARRATION/DAREDEVIL - And why does it hurt MORE when I'm thinking?


7-- In the final part of this sequence, Daredevil is no longer being punched, and has a look of abject horror upon his face.

NARRATION/DAREDEVIL - ...No

SPEECH BUBBLE/DAREDEVIL - ..... N-no!


8-- Finally we get to see his assailant, looming over DD's beaten body. It is a giant Thought Balloon, with two of the edges of the balloon stretched out into huge fists. Behind it is a huge lightning strike

SFX/LIGHTNING BOLT - DUNDUNDUUUUUUUUN!

THOUGHT BALLOON/THOUGHT BALLOON - What's the matter DD, can you not sense..... THE THOUGHT BALLOON?!
